About Cross Green

Cross Green is an inner-city district located directly to the east-southeast of Leeds city centre in West Yorkshire, England. Historically, it has been a significant industrial and manufacturing hub, contributing to Leeds's industrial heritage, and today features a mix of commercial, light industrial, and residential premises. Its strategic location provides good access to major road networks and the city centre, making it an integral part of the wider Leeds urban fabric.
